ÔÚLinuxÉÏʹÓÃEclipse¾ÙÐÐC++±à³ÌµÄÍƼöÉèÖÃ
ÎÊÌ⣺ÔÚc++olor:#f60; text-decoration:underline;’ href=”https://www.php.cn/zt/15718.html” target=”_blank”>linuxÉÏʹÓÃeclipse¾ÙÐÐc++±à³ÌµÄÍƼöÉèÖÃ
СÐò£º
Eclipse×÷Ϊһ¿î¹¦Ð§Ç¿Ê¢µÄ¼¯³É¿ª·¢ÇéÐΣ¨IDE£©£¬¿ÉÒÔΪC++¿ª·¢ÕßÌṩ±ã½ÝºÍ¸ßЧµÄ±à³ÌÇéÐΡ£±¾ÎĽ«ÎªÄúÏÈÈÝÔÚLinuxÉÏʹÓÃEclipse¾ÙÐÐC++±à³ÌµÄÍƼöÉèÖ㬲¢ÌṩһЩÊÊÓõĴúÂëʾÀý£¬Ö¼ÔÚ×ÊÖúÄú¸üºÃµØʹÓÃEclipse¿ªÕ¹C++ÏîÄ¿¿ª·¢¡£
Ò»¡¢×°ÖÃEclipse£º
Ê×ÏÈ£¬ÎÒÃÇÐèÒªÔÚLinuxϵͳÉÏ×°ÖÃEclipse¡£Äú¿ÉÒÔ´ÓEclipse¹ÙÍø£¨https://www.eclipse.org/downloads/£©ÉÏÏÂÔØ×îеÄC++°æ±¾¡£
Ò»Ñùƽ³£À´Ëµ£¬ÔÚLinuxµÄÏÂÁîÐнçÃæʹÓÃÒÔÏÂÏÂÁî¾ÙÐÐ×°Öãº
sudo apt-get install eclipse-cdt
µÇ¼ºó¸´ÖÆ
×°ÖÃÍê³Éºó£¬Äú¿ÉÒÔÔÚÆô¶¯²Ëµ¥»òÓ¦ÓóÌÐòÁбíÖÐÕÒµ½Eclipse²¢ÔËÐС£
Á¬Ã¦Ñ§Ï°¡°C++Ãâ·ÑѧϰÌõ¼Ç£¨ÉîÈ룩¡±£»
¶þ¡¢ÉèÖÃEclipseÇéÐΣº
ÉèÖÃÊÂÇéÇø£º
ÔÚÊ×´ÎÔËÐÐEclipseʱ£¬Ëü»áÒªÇóÄúÑ¡ÔñÒ»¸öÊÂÇéÇø£¬ÕâÊÇÄú´æ·ÅC++ÏîÄ¿µÄλÖá£Æ¾Ö¤Ð¡ÎÒ˽ÈËϲ»¶Ñ¡ÔñÒ»¸öºÏÊʵÄÎļþ¼Ð£¬²¢È·±£ÊÂÇéÇøĿ¼¾ßÓÐÊʵ±µÄ¶ÁдȨÏÞ¡£
½¨ÉèC++ÏîÄ¿£º
ÔÚEclipseµÄ²Ëµ¥À¸ÖÐÒÀ´ÎÑ¡Ôñ¡°File¡± -> ¡°New¡± -> ¡°C++ Project¡±£¬È»ºóƾ֤ÌáÐÑÑ¡ÔñºÏÊʵÄÏîÄ¿Ãû³ÆºÍÏîÄ¿ÀàÐÍ¡£ÀýÈ磬ѡÔñ¡°Executable¡±ÀàÐͽ«½¨ÉèÒ»¸ö¿ÉÖ´ÐеÄC++ÏîÄ¿¡£
ÉèÖñàÒëÆ÷£º
EclipseĬÈÏʹÓÃGNU±àÒëÆ÷ÜöÝÍ£¨GCC£©×÷ΪC++µÄ±àÒëÆ÷£¬¿ÉÒÔÔÚ¡°Project¡± -> ¡°Properties¡± -> ¡°C/C++ Build¡±ÖоÙÐÐÉèÖá£ÔÚÕâÀÄú¿ÉÒÔÉèÖñàÒëÆ÷µÄ·¾¶¡¢±àÒëÑ¡ÏîµÈ¡£
´úÂëʾÀý1 – Hello World³ÌÐò£º
ÏÂÃæÊÇÒ»¸ö¼òÆÓµÄHello World³ÌÐòʾÀý£º
#include <iostream> int main() { std::cout << "Hello, World!" << std::endl; return 0; }
µÇ¼ºó¸´ÖÆ
´úÂëʾÀý2 – ¼Ó·¨ÅÌËãÆ÷£º
ÏÂÃæÊÇÒ»¸ö¼òÆӵļӷ¨ÅÌËãÆ÷ʾÀý£º
#include <iostream> int main() { int num1, num2; std::cout << "Enter two numbers: "; std::cin >> num1 >> num2; int sum = num1 + num2; std::cout << "Sum is: " << sum << std::endl; return 0; }
µÇ¼ºó¸´ÖÆ
±¸×¢£ºÒÔÉÏ´úÂëʾÀý¿ÉÒÔÔÚÏîÄ¿Öн¨ÉèÒ»¸öеÄC++Ô´Îļþ£¬²¢½«´úÂ븴ÖƵ½Ô´ÎļþÖУ¬È»ºóͨ¹ýEclipseµÄ¡°Build¡±¹¦Ð§¾ÙÐбàÒëºÍÔËÐС£
½áÓ
ͨ¹ý׼ȷµÄÉèÖúÍʹÓÃEclipse£¬Äú¿ÉÒÔÔÚLinuxÉÏÀû±ãµØ¾ÙÐÐC++±à³Ì¡£±¾ÎÄÏÈÈÝÁËEclipseµÄ×°ÖúÍÉèÖÃÀú³Ì£¬²¢ÌṩÁËÁ½¸ö¼òÆÓµÄC++´úÂëʾÀý¡£Ï£ÍûÕâЩÄÚÈÝÄܹ»×ÊÖúÄú¸üºÃµØʹÓÃEclipse¾ÙÐÐC++ÏîÄ¿¿ª·¢¡£×£Äú±à³ÌÓä¿ì£¡
ÒÔÉϾÍÊÇÔÚLinuxÉÏʹÓÃEclipse¾ÙÐÐC++±à³ÌµÄÍƼöÉèÖõÄÏêϸÄÚÈÝ£¬¸ü¶àÇë¹Ø×¢±¾ÍøÄÚÆäËüÏà¹ØÎÄÕ£¡